Union meets with Service Canada over federal budget issues

The recently announced federal budget contains changes to Employment Insurance (EI) that will have an impact on the CEIU members delivering the program. In response, CEIU met with senior management figures to discuss the effects of these changes on members who are already struggling with rapidly escalating work loads.

“We recognize the pressures on management in light of the budget and the climbing work load” said National President Jeannette Meunier-McKay, “but those pressures end up on the desks of our members and we need solutions that make sense for staff and the public we serve. We need support systems and staffing plans to deal with these problems and must not rely on continuous overtime that simply burns people out.” She went on to say that along with backlogs in claims processing comes a higher number of desperate claimants whose frustration can sometimes lead to abusive behaviour: “Dealing with irate claimants is extremely unpleasant no matter how much you may sympathize with their situation. It’s all the more reason to find an effective solution to these backlogs as quickly as possible.”

CEIU will meet regularly with management to review the progress of efforts to deal with the challenges facing Service Canada. Locals are asked to pass along members’ concerns and suggestions to the National Vice-President(s) for their region who will in turn keep the union’s national office informed.
